From 8052755fd7581d70802f651d88b7af8447432d75 Mon Sep 17 00:00:00 2001 From: Timur Pocheptsov Date: Thu, 8 Aug 2019 16:12:46 +0200 Subject: Add means to configure HTTP/2 protocol handler Similar to TLS configuration that we can use on QNetworkRequest, we can configure different options in our HTTP/2 handling by providing QNetworkAccessManager with h2 configuration. Previously, it was only possible internally in our auto-test - a hack with QObject's properties and a private class. Now it's time to provide a public API for this.
